What 11379NAT Really Is

The full title is the 11379NAT Course in Initial Response to a Mental Health Crisis. It is an across the country certified brief course in Australia, provided on training.gov.au, and provided by Registered Training Organisations under ASQA accredited courses structures. Unlike a wide mental health certificate that covers long-term problems and psychosocial assistance, this training course is purpose constructed for the initial mins to hours of a dilemma. It teaches you to secure the circumstance, decrease immediate risk, and connect the individual to suitable help.

People who finish the 11379NAT mental health course commonly work in roles where situation can emerge without warning: front-line supervisors, educators, safety and security, customer service, physical fitness personnel, HR, union representatives, volunteers, and community leaders. It additionally matches any individual functioning as a mental health support officer inside an organisation, specifically where peer support and very early intervention are priorities.

The credentials is part of nationally accredited training. That implies the material, analysis problems, and results are standardised and investigated. When employers request for accredited mental health courses or a mental health certification that is portable throughout states and markets, this training course remains on the short list that satisfies that test.

The Point of a Dilemma Course, Not Therapy

A crisis mental health course varies from counselling training or a basic mental health course in one crucial way. It asks, what must be done securely right now? A situation can include suicidal thinking with a plan, self-harm, severe anxiousness or panic that interferes with function, extreme https://rowanrfnv895.lowescouponn.com/courses-in-mental-health-discovering-the-most-effective-fit-for-your-job depressive episodes, substance-related distress, psychosis with or without anxiety, and reactions to trauma. The training mind and body connection course instructs you to recognise the indications, carry out preliminary threat checks, and choose the next finest activity within your scope.

You will not appear as a clinician. You will not detect. You will certainly learn a trusted method that prevents typical mistakes: reducing the individual's distress, leaping straight to advice, missing out on safety and security threats, or escalating a scenario via bad language or posture. Think of it as emergency treatment for mental health, the way a physical first aid course takes care of blood loss or burns. You offer preliminary treatment and turn over to the right degree of support.

Core Skills You Can Expect to Practise

This isn't a slide-deck program. The better companies build real scenario infiltrate every system and examine exactly how you use skills with individuals, not simply how you remember realities. Over the arc of the course, you ought to practice:

    Recognising an establishing mental health crisis and distinguishing it from routine distress. The line can be blurred. The program instructs you to try to find adjustments in speech, stance, frustration, comprehensibility, feeling of reality, and statements about harm. Establishing first get in touch with that prioritises safety and security and self-respect. You will obtain comfortable with plain language, non-threatening position and spacing, and permission where appropriate. Asking direct inquiries concerning suicide or self-harm without euphemisms. You find out to use specific, respectful phrasing and exactly how to handle your own discomfort while you evaluate risk. De-escalation and grounding methods. Simple, repeatable methods for regulating breathing, decreasing stimulation, and lowering stimuli in the environment. Safety planning and instant referral. Understanding when to call triple no, just how to include household or assistance individuals with authorization, and how to document activities in line with policy.

Those are the hands-on pieces. You also cover lawful and honest boundaries, personal privacy and consent, mandated coverage in specific contexts, and the navigating of local solution paths. The better programs localise the recommendation map, due to the fact that "call someone" is useless if you do not know that and exactly how at 3 a.m.

Units, Analysis, and What 'Proficiency' Means

Nationally accredited training makes use of competency-based evaluation. You are considered qualified when you constantly demonstrate the needed skills and understanding under realistic conditions. With 11379NAT, that normally incorporates expertise consult observed simulations and scenario-based wondering about. Expect role-play with a facilitator or star, created reactions to case studies, and a sensible assessment where you must apply a structured feedback to a specified crisis.

Time commitments differ by carrier, yet a regular distribution extends one to 2 full days with pre-reading, after that functional evaluation tasks. Some suppliers divided it across shorter sessions to accommodate shift workers. You'll frequently have between 6 and 12 hours of get in touch with time, with additional time for analysis completion.

The certificate of attainment you obtain is recognised across Australia since it sits within nationally accredited courses. Employers who ask for evidence of first aid in mental health or emergency treatment for mental health training will identify it, and insurance providers increasingly seek accredited training on data when they underwrite programs linked to psychosocial hazards.

The Refresher Question: When and Why

Competency discolors. The 11379NAT mental health correspondence course exists for that reason. Policies differ by employer, but a 12 to 24 month refresher course cycle prevails. The mental health refresher course 11379NAT is much shorter, typically half a day, and focuses on skill rehearsal, updates to standards, and scenario experiment fresh, high-friction instances. If your role includes regular call with the public or trainees, rejuvenating yearly is more than a compliance box. It keeps your language sharp and your self-confidence intact.

One indicator that a refresher is overdue: you hesitate to ask a straight inquiry regarding suicide. Another: you find yourself skipping to suggestions as opposed to analysis. What Counts as a Mental Wellness Crisis?

Definitions differ by policy, but you can acknowledge a situation by the convergence of danger, damaged feature, and time stress. Instances include a teenager that has stopped resting for days and is hearing voices, a worker that admits to having a plan for suicide and the methods to carry it out, a client in obvious panic shaking and gasping, unable to speak, or an individual under the influence whose behaviour swings swiftly and unpredictably.

The course does not ask you to decide reason. It trains you to assess immediate risk and respond. Also in grey areas, the 11379NAT strategy assists. If an individual is distressed and possibly at risk but participating, you move toward grounding, encouraging talk, and connection to solutions. If there is imminent threat, you prioritise emergency situation solutions and safety and security for all entailed. In either instance, your language appears, your position is non-confrontational, and your documents is factual.

Assessment Nerves and How to Take care of Them

Plenty of competent individuals tighten at the concept of role-play. The trick is to treat the evaluation like a drill, not a performance. You can make it much easier on yourself by exercising 3 anchors the evening prior to:

    Openers: a couple of words to begin with security and authorization. "I'm observing you seem actually bewildered. I would love to check exactly how you're really feeling and see to it you're secure. Is it alright if we speak right here, or would you choose someplace quieter?" Direct risk inquiries: short, clear, no euphemisms. "Are you thinking of suicide?" "Have you thought about just how you might do it?" "Do you have access to what you 'd make use of?" Handovers: concise, factual, and joint. "You have actually informed me the ideas are intense and you've thought of pills. I'm worried concerning your safety and security. Allow's call the crisis line together now, and I can stay while we speak with them."

These are not manuscripts to recite. They are waypoints you can adjust. In an evaluation, the assessor looks for proof that you discovered indicators, asked straight, lowered instant threat, and linked support. Elegant wording thrills nobody. Clearness does.

Ethical Edges and Grey Areas

Real life will evaluate the neatness of any training. 2 repeating side cases are worthy of attention.

First, privacy versus security. If an individual discloses self-destructive intent and asks you not to tell any individual, you can not promise privacy where safety is at danger. The course educates language that appreciates freedom while being honest regarding limits. "I value your personal privacy, and I'll keep this as exclusive as I can, however I can not keep this to myself if your safety is at threat. Let's exercise with each other that we entail."

Second, approval and capacity. In severe psychosis or drunkenness, a person might not have the ability to consent to certain activities. The course helps you acknowledge when to intensify to emergency solutions and exactly how to interact comfortably while assistance gets on the way. Your function is to decrease the temperature, reduce stimuli, and maintain physical safety front of mind.

In both situations, regional policy and legislation assist the last telephone call. Excellent training factors you to those frameworks instead of leaving you to guess.

A Brief, Practical Checklist You Can Utilize Tomorrow

    Notice and name: state what you're observing without judgment, welcome a quick check-in, and select a quieter room if possible. Ask directly about injury: utilize clear, considerate concerns about suicide or self-harm, and pay attention to the solutions without flinching. Lower arousal: reduce noise and crowding, slow your speech, suggest paced breathing or a focal item, and prevent unexpected movements. Decide on the handover: crisis line, GP, emergency situation solutions, or a trusted assistance individual, and involve the individual in the choice where safe. Document factually: time, observations, exact wording where relevant, actions taken, and that you turned over to, in accordance with policy.

Pin this where your group can see it. It mirrors the spinal column of the course and keeps every person aligned.
